CURRENT EXHIBITION - MARCH 13 - APRIL 25

Veils of Becoming explores the quiet yet profound transformation of the feminine.

In a society where success is often driven by
masculine ideals—fast and uncompromising—this exhibition embraces a different
kind of evolution: intuitive, spiritual, and deeply creative.

Through the works of Emma Sloth, LOUui Studio, and Helena Rye, we witness personal and artistic growth unfolding naturally. Their
art moves between the seen and the unseen, balancing strength and vulnerability, stillness and movement.

Each piece invites the viewer into a reflective space where transformation is not abrupt, but steady and considerate
—one veil at a time.

a curator with a vision

Karen Dulong, curator and founder of Galeria 18, has created a gallery that balances aesthetics with depth and relevance.

Growing up with art and entrepreneurship as a natural part of her life, she brings a passionate approach to her exhibitions. Karen is dedicated to creating platforms for upcoming artists, fostering connections between their work and a broader audience.

Through her careful curation, the gallery also offers collectors the opportunity to invest in promising talent at the beginning of their artistic journey.
